I’m not sure if many of you were aware, but back in April, I was on the Dr. Phil show! No, it wasn’t an episode where I was exposing my family or personal drama. Instead, I had the chance to do a lifestyle segment and be an Olay Beauty Expert.
If you’re a part of the N Crowd (if you’re not then you should be), you know that I’ve been on a mission to host a lifestyle TV show. That is my life-long dream! However, while on that quest I’ve discovered my love for doing lifestyle segments on local news stations. For a while, my goal (within that realm) has been: secure a national lifestyle segment. I love doing segments so much, that I could literally become a resident lifestyle expert on GMA, The View, The Real.. etc. There aren’t a lot of black women in that space and I felt like I could fill that void. What’s a resident lifestyle expert, you ask? Well, it’s just a fancy way of saying someone who only does lifestyle segments for that national TV show. Make sense?! Good!
So, back to my original thought. When I got the call that I was selected to be the Beauty Expert for this national TV show, I was so thrilled. I was actually witnessing one of my affirmations manifest (I will talk about manifestation in another post). It was a feeling I have yet to figure out how to put into words. I was going to record the whole process of the taping from start to finish, but I needed to focus solely on the segment and nothing else.
Once I was confirmed to be on the Dr. Phil Show, I had to go over the paperwork, submit everything to the teams, and coordinate my schedule. On the backend, I had to make sure that I had the appropriate equipment. From a good microphone set up to a cute outfit, I had a lot to do before showtime. Keep in mind I’m doing all of this from home in the middle of a pandemic/lockdown.
THE NIGHT BEFORE SHOWTIME
The night before showtime, we had a tech rehearsal which included setting up/staging my apartment. I went from:

Once we figured out the set-up, then we tested my microphone, Zoom, Skype, the placement of my camera. Good Gawd, there was so much tech stuff!! Luckily, I’m tech savvy so I was able to figure everything out smoothly. We kept everything exactly in the same spot so the next day we’d be up and running with no issues.
